Choosing a quiet window cleaning robot involves more than just looking at noise ratings. You’ll want to consider how well it cleans, how easy it is to operate, and whether it fits your safety requirements. The right model should match your window types, household environment, and budget. Here are some critical factors to keep in mind:Noise Levels
Look for models specifically designed for low noise operation, especially if you’ll use the robot frequently or during quiet hours. Some robots feature brushless motors or sound-dampening design elements to minimize disruption. Keep in mind that a quieter device might compromise a bit on suction power or cleaning speed, so weigh your priorities carefully.
Cleaning Performance
Effective cleaning depends on the design of the spray system, brush quality, and suction strength. Robots with dual nozzles or ultrasonic spray tend to distribute cleaning solution evenly and reduce streaks. Consider your window types—smooth glass versus textured surfaces—and choose a robot that adapts well to your specific needs.
Navigation and Safety Features
Smart navigation, including AI path planning and edge detection, ensures thorough cleaning and prevents falls or collisions. A reliable anti-fall system and sturdy safety harness are essential, especially for large or high-rise windows. Devices with auto-return or emergency stop functions add peace of mind during operation.
Ease of Use and Controls
Intuitive controls via remote or app simplify operation, especially for those less comfortable with tech. Automated features like scheduling and auto-clean stations save time. Ensure the robot’s setup process is straightforward and that it offers clear status indicators for troubleshooting.
Value and Price
Higher-priced models often include advanced features like ultrasonic spray, multi-directional cleaning, and integrated stations, but may not be necessary for smaller or less demanding tasks. Conversely, budget options might lack quiet operation or safety features but can still deliver satisfactory cleaning for lower-rise windows or occasional use. Balance your expectations with your budget to find the best fit.
Frequently Asked Questions
How quiet are these window cleaning robots in real-world use?
Most models in this roundup operate at noise levels between 50-65 decibels, comparable to a quiet conversation or background music. Quieter models tend to have brushless motors and sound-dampening design features, which significantly reduce noise without sacrificing cleaning power. However, extremely quiet devices may have slightly lower suction or slower operation, so consider your priority between noise and performance.
Can I use these robots on all types of windows?
While most models suit standard smooth glass, some are better equipped for textured, tinted, or larger windows. Robots with adjustable suction and spray systems can handle various surfaces more effectively. Always check the manufacturer’s specifications to ensure compatibility with your window types, especially for large or high-demand installations.
How safe are these robots for high-rise or large windows?
Safety features like anti-fall sensors, emergency stop buttons, and safety harnesses are common in higher-end models. Many include auto-return functions if they lose contact or encounter issues. For very large or high-rise windows, choosing a model with comprehensive safety measures is vital to prevent accidents or damage during operation.
Do I need to supervise these robots while they clean?
While many models are designed for autonomous operation, supervision is recommended, especially during initial uses or on challenging windows. Features like remote control and app monitoring enable you to oversee the process easily. Always follow the manufacturer’s safety instructions to avoid mishaps or damage.
How often should I clean or maintain the robot for optimal quiet operation?
Regular maintenance, including cleaning spray nozzles, replacing pads, and checking suction vents, ensures the robot runs quietly and efficiently. Dust and residue buildup can cause noise and reduce performance. Following the manufacturer’s recommended maintenance schedule helps keep the device operating smoothly and quietly over time.
